"Sherry, we are in a bigger mess." Jiya's fearful voice came from the other side of the phone.
"Jiya, stop creating suspense. Just tell me what happened." Sheherbano irritatedly asked, as her patience dried off.
"Shams send the proposal for you." Closing her eyes, Jiya spurted out the words and put the phone away from her ear. Expecting Sheherbano's wrath.
"I.... what?" But Sheherbano cackle out a loud laugh and asked.
"Achha mazak hai..." Laughing, she added.
(Nice joke.)
"Sheherbano, Main mazak nahi kar rahi hoon." Jiya sternly called her.
(I'm not joking.)
"Mazak nahi hai toh kya hai? Shams ka rishta mere liye... I mean really?" Sheherbano also become serious but in end again laughed. But her laugh was now hallow and humourless.
(Then what it is? Like Shams really sent the proposal for me...)
"Really! Shams ne tumhare liye rishta bheja hai kyuki.... pata nahi kyu. Lekin maine itna suna ki unhe tumse nikkah karna hai." A loud gasp left Sheherbano's lips when she realized Jiya is telling the truth.
(Shams really sent the proposal for you..... I don't know why he did that but...
"What? Unhone waqai mein aisa kiya? How could... Achha, ab hum samjhe....." Her voice become undertone, as she asked herself these questions.
(He really sent the proposal for me? How could... Now I understand...)
"Kya?" Jiya couldn't understand what she was saying. Before Sheherbano could answer her, Sheherbano's female colleagues walked passed by her, talking about Shams Malik. Which made Sheherbano more annoyance.
(What?)
"Shams Malik! ab hum apko batate hain." She furiously whispered.
(I'll see you.)
"Samajhte kya hain yeh khud ko? Aise hi humare liye proposal bhejenge aur hum accept kar lenge? Inki toh hum abhi khabar lete hain."
(What does he think by sending me his proposal?)
"Sherry, tum kya keh rahi ho?" Jiya, who was listening to her jabbering, asked in confusion.
(What are you saying?)
"Jiya, main tumhe baad mein call karti."
(I'll call you later.)
"Magar, Sherry... Sherry, suno kuch ulta seedha mat karna...Sherry!" Jiya kept saying but Sheherbano disconnected the call.
(But, Sherry... Sherry, don't do anything stupid... Sherry!)
Putting her phone in her bag, rolling up her sleeves, she started going where Shams Malik is.
"Ma'am, kaha ja rahi hain?" The attendant stopped her on the door and asked.
(Where are you going, Ma'am ?)
"Shams Malik se milne." Sheherbano didn't stop for him, replying him, she barged in.
(To meet Shams Malik.)
"Ma'am, woh meeting mein hain." Behind her, he told her and also entered the board room.
(He is in a meeting.)
Six members of the board, four foreign clients and Shams Malik, eleven pairs of eyes turned to her. And Sheherbano Ali froze there. She was expecting him alone but the crowd there removed her all rage and replaced it by anxiety.

Shams Malik couldn't say a thing, as he stared at her motionlessly. He averts his eyes away from her to the board members, when he saw one of his foreign client looking at Sheherbano from her head to toe.
Shams clenched his fist. "Miss Sheherbano Ali." He called her in a low throaty growl.
Being in the centre of attention to everyone, Sheherbano couldn't see anything, neither hear him.
Shams cleared his throat and get up, other members present there were about to get up too but he showed them his hand, closing the buttons of his coat, he stood in front of her.
Sheherbano's eyes were fixed on his brown shiny shoes when she raised her head to meet his gaze.
"Miss Sheherbano, kya apko itna nahi maloom
ki iss tarah board meeting mein nahi atey." His voice was low, only she was able to hear him carefully just because if their closeness.
(Don't you know better than to barge in a board meeting like this?)
"I... I..." She meekly manages to speak.
"What I? Just leave from here." He raised his voice, which made her jump.
She didn't waste another second and ran away from there.
β’β’β’
"Ek toh rishta bhi khud hi bheja aur ab daat bhi khud hi rahe hain.... woh bhi sabke samne." Crying, Sheherbano complained to herself. She was sitting in the lounge area, tearing tissue paper in pieces and throwing it on the floor. The lounge was almost empty, except for the sweeper who was working in a corner.
(First, he sent ne his proposal. And now, he is the one scolding me.... in front of everyone.)
"Yeh bhi koi baat hoti hai..." Wiping her tears by her hand, she said. When someone put their handkerchief in front of her.
(What kind of behaviour it is?)
She was about to take it when saw who it was. Nawab Shams Malik was in front of her. Which made her gasp.
Her mouth huffed air in, as she looked at her left to avoid looking at him.
Taking the cue, sweeper left from there. Now, they both were alone in the huge area of the lounge.
"Le lijiye... your nose is..." Shams told her while pointing at her nose. This made Sheherbano sniffed.
(Take it...)
She quickly took some tissues out from tissue box and wipe her nose.
"Baat karni thi apko?" He sat beside her and asked.
(You wanted to talk about something?)
Sheherbano opened her mouth to say something but was stopped by sniff.
"Itna nahi kaha tha jitna aap ro rahi hain." Shams couldn't help but wonder.
(What I said to make you cry?)
"Mujhse... Mujhse kabhi kisine uchi awaz mein baat nahi ki." Sheherbano choked out her words in between her sniffles from crying.
(No one... No one raised their voice at me.)
"Main agey se dhyan rakhunga iss baat ka... Um! Water?" When he saw that her cries weren't stopping but only increasing, he asked and quickly got up to fetch a glass of water for her.

(I'll keep that in my mind.)
"Here!" Sitting beside her, he gave her the glass of water.
Taking it, she chugged down the water in one breath.
"Thank you."
"So, what you wanted to talk about?" When she calmed down, Shams again asked.
"I..." Sheherbano opened her mouth when got interrupted by Shams P.A
"Sir, Mr Affandi is here." He informed Shams.
Shams nod his head and dismissed him.
"Aap ghar jaiye. Jo bhi baat hogi hum ghar pe karenge." He turned to Sheherbano and told her. Not waiting for her answer, he left. Sheherbano's mouth was almost touching the floor.
(Go home, Sheherbano. We would talk about it later.)
"Baat bhi matlab ab inke hisab se hogi?" Sheherbano angrily asked.
(We will talk according to his mood?)
β’β’β’
"Dekhiye, agar aap meri baat se offend hue then I'm really sorry. But aap Sherry ko kyu beech mein la rahe hain." Jiya asked Shams on phone.
(If you are angry at me then I'm really sorry. But why did you send a proposal for Sherry?)
"Jiya, I think you are unaware of the pact which our fathers made. Your father agreed to marry his daughter to me, which were you. But now, I don't think it is appropriate for us to marry. This means Sheherbano is the ideal bride for me."
"Pa... Pact? What kind of pact?" Jiya's eyes widened because of this information. She never thought her marriage was a deal. This
proposal was nothing but for business benefit.
Jiya's breath was ragged but slow. Afraid Shams would hear it, she took the phone away from her ear and lips. A few tears rolled down to her cheeks, feeling deceived by her own father. She quickly wiped her tears and cleared her throat.
"Hello!" Shams call was still connected. Taking a sharp breath, Jiya again put the phone on her ear.
"Are you okay?" Her voice was feeble, which made him ask.
"I'm fine. We were supposed to marry na, then we should marry each other. Sherry ko in sab mein mat uljhaiye." Jiya made her voice hard and told him.
(Don't bring Sherry in this.)
"I'm sorry, Jiya, but mujhe uss ladki se shaadi nahi karni jiske dil mein koi aur ho." Saying this, Shams disconnected the call.
(I won't marry the girl who is in love with someone else.)
β’β’β’
"Hum kuch nahi kar sakte, Sherry." Jiya said. She was feeling most defenceless. Sheherbano was her little and because of her stupidity, she got stuck in Jiya's mess. But Jiya couldn't even help her.
(We can't do anything.)
"Par... Clear one thing for me, Jiya, how did Abba say yes? Why he didn't ask them to get lost? Why?" Sheherbano, who was munching sandwich to calm herself down, asked and picked the glass of soft drink.
(But...)
Jiya avoided looking at Sheherbano. She didn't want to break Sheherbano's heart. Poor girl thinks of Shahmir Ali as her own father and loves him like that. What will happen to her once she got to know her father fixed her marriage just for business. Her father doesn't value her feelings neither emotions. Jiya didn't want to crush the poor girl's heart.
"Waise Ammi aur Abba ne ab tak mujhse iss barey mein baat nahi ki. Shayad unn log ne rishte se mana kar diya." Sheherbano hopefully asked. Jiya shook her head
(But, Ammi and Aba didn't talk to me about this proposal yet. Maybe they refused The Maliks.)
"Meri abhi Shams se baat hui." She informed Sheherbano.
(I just talked to Shams.)
"What? What did he call you now?" Sheherbano put the glass on the tray and angrily asked.
"He didn't call me. I did. I wanted to know why he sent the proposal for you."
"Thank god you asked him. Because if I had, I would have lost my temper and would have said something foul to him." Sheherbano wisely nodded her head.
"Waise what he said?"
"He said... He said... Said that... That he won't marry a girl who loves someone else."
"He isn't wrong. But that doesn't answer why he sent the proposal for me." Sheherbano again nodded her head, agreeing with Shams.
"I guess because... Because the news of Nawab Shams Malik and Shahmir Ali's daughter is such a big headline... Maybe he is doing this for his reputation." Jiya said the first thing which came in her mind.
"Reputation? Then why did Abba said yes? He should have refused them."
"Maybe because Abba itna achha rishta khona nahi chahte."
(Abba didn't want to lose a nice guy like him.)
"Achha rishta? Woh bhi yeh? Jiya, woh jo shaks haina..." Sheherbano put the lock of her hair behind her ear and sat properly to face Jiya.
(Nice guy? Him? That guy is a...)
"Bohot khadoos hain... Din bhar office mein kabhi issey daat rahe hain toh kabbi ussey. Har ek minute pe kisina kisi ke daat-te rehte hain. Aaj toh hume bhi daata. Woh bhi pure board member ke samne." Sheherbano's eyes watered when remembered the insult.
(He is very rude. He is always in a foul temper, always scolding someone. He even scolded me in front of board members.)
"I don't want to marry him." She mumbled while looking down.
"I'm sorry, Sherry. If I had known... I would have never called him that day." Jiya hugged her.
"Call? Yes, call." Sheherbano suddenly becomes excited, as she broke the hug.
"What?" Jiya didn't understand the change in her mood and confusingly asked.
